Transaction 77e571d8e8b3048082d195e28d7a5f4023809a894a91eb4b1fb322759ec43667
1 Input
2 Outputs
- 77e571d8e8b3048082d195e28d7a5f4023809a894a91eb4b1fb322759ec43667:0
- 77e571d8e8b3048082d195e28d7a5f4023809a894a91eb4b1fb322759ec43667:1
value 505899
address 386Xd6354RfD1mSA8efZaJUpjLQD7K6E5x
value 1093774
address 1FWRY85ENYA188AWxjKcpRpd9ZN3JWatn6